Guide con-rod and insert piston until big end
makes contact with the bearing journal.
PMTAB_Picture
Fit con-rod bearing shells into bearing caps.
Fit bearing caps, making sure the numbers are
matching.
Note:
Numbers on bearing cap and big end must be
on the same side.
Chamfered side (Arrow) on con- rod cap must
show toward cooling oil nozzle.
PMTAB_Picture
Note:
Never reuse con-rod bearing bolts .
Insert new con-rod bearing bolts and gradually
tighten to specified torque.
Use torque angle indicator for final tightening
process.
